A-methylbenzylzinc bromide is an organozinc compound with the chemical formula C8H9ZnBr. It is a colorless to pale yellow liquid that is highly sensitive to air and moisture. This reagent is commonly used in organic synthesis, particularly in the formation of carbon-carbon bonds through the Negishi coupling reaction. It is prepared by reacting A-methylbenzyl bromide with zinc metal in a suitable solvent, such as tetrahydrofuran or diethyl ether. A-methylbenzylzinc bromide is a valuable intermediate in the synthesis of various pharmaceuticals, agrochemicals, and other specialty chemicals due to its ability to form stable organozinc intermediates that can be used in cross-coupling reactions with a wide range of electrophiles.

Check Digit Verification of cas no

The CAS Registry Mumber 85459-20-7 includes 8 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 5 digits, 8,5,4,5 and 9 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 2 and 0 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 85459-20:
(7*8)+(6*5)+(5*4)+(4*5)+(3*9)+(2*2)+(1*0)=157
157 % 10 = 7
So 85459-20-7 is a valid CAS Registry Number.
